Both NetSuite RESTlet and SuiteScript approaches require significant custom development and face the same underlying governance limits when handling multi-million row extracts. RESTlets hit the 15 simultaneous API call base limit and execution time constraints, while SuiteScript faces similar governance restrictions.
Here’s how to skip the development complexity entirely and get reliable multi-million row data extraction without choosing between technical approaches.
Eliminate custom development with automated solutions using Coefficient
Coefficient eliminates the need to choose between RESTlet vs SuiteScript approaches by providing a no-code solution that leverages NetSuite ‘s REST Web Services through OAuth 2.0 authentication. The platform automatically deploys and manages RESTlet scripts for API communication, handling version control and compatibility checking without manual script development.
How to make it work
Step 1. Complete the one-time OAuth setup without custom script development.
Your NetSuite admin configures the OAuth 2.0 connection once, and Coefficient automatically handles RESTlet script deployment. The system manages version control, compatibility checking, and script updates without requiring custom development or maintenance.
Step 2. Configure multi-million row extracts using Records & Lists method.
Select your target record type and apply filters to segment your large dataset. NetSuite automatically handles pagination, error recovery, and retry logic that would require extensive custom coding in traditional RESTlet or SuiteScript implementations.
Step 3. Set up automated scheduling for continuous extraction.
Configure hourly, daily, or weekly refresh schedules to create continuous data extraction pipelines. The system automatically manages NetSuite’s concurrency limits and rate limiting without the operational overhead of monitoring custom script deployments or handling governance limit exceptions.
Step 4. Enable incremental sync capabilities for ongoing data management.
Use date-based filtering and automated refresh scheduling to create incremental sync operations. This provides continuous data extraction without the complexity of managing custom script execution logs or handling version compatibility issues that plague custom NetSuite development approaches.
Get enterprise-scale data extraction without the development overhead
This approach combines the reliability of RESTlet-based API access with intelligent automation that eliminates custom development requirements. You get multi-million row extraction capabilities without choosing between technical approaches or managing script deployments. Start extracting your large datasets with automated NetSuite integration today.